Lee Westwood upbeat despite slow start

Lee Westwood is not letting his slow start to the season get him down.

The Englishman tied for 15th place at the Omega Desert Classic, continuing his slightly lacklustre 2011.

In the previous two tournaments in his golf clothing, the world number one tied for 64th in one and missed the cut in the other.

"I'm not a great start-of-the-year player," the Nottingham Post reported the 37-year-old as saying.

"I finished the year off well last year, but I'm struggling a bit to get going this year. My glass is always half full, though. Having been through bad times in my career - much worse than finishing 15th - I am always able to enjoy playing golf."

Westwood finished poorly in Dubai, carding two sixes to slip down the leaderboard.

Spaniard Alvaro Quiros was crowned winner after a dramatic final round of 68 saw him claim victory by one shot.
